City Council
The council will hold a final public hearing on the 2025 preliminary budget, then vote on an ordinance to adopt the 2025 budget and an ordinance amending the 2024 budget. Other actions include a cannabis ordinance, adoption of the 2025 fee schedule and school impact fees, a sewer plan addendum, a comprehensive emergency management plan, and a fuel tax agreement for the Roberts Drive Reconstruction project. The consent agenda includes claim checks totaling $1,029,680.95 and payroll of $597,423.77, as well as final plat approvals for two Ten Trails subdivisions.

City Council
At the November 7, 2024 meeting, the Black Diamond City Council will hold public hearings on proposed cannabis regulations, a comprehensive plan amendment adding school capital facility plans, and the 2025 preliminary budget. The council will also consider ordinances adopting the percentage increase and total dollars for 2025 property taxes. Consent agenda items include claim checks totaling $628,910.96, an interlocal agreement with Issaquah for jail services, and final plat approval for The Villages Ten Trails Mountain View 1B Plat A Division 4.

City Council
The Black Diamond, Covington, and Maple Valley councils are holding their 16th annual joint meeting. The agenda includes a presentation from King County Councilmember Reagan Dunn and city updates from each municipality. Discussion topics include public safety coordination and community care services.
